Sertralina Teva is a generic pharmaceutical product containing sertraline hydrochloride, a sel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) used primarily to treat depression and anxiety disorders. The brand Teva has its historical roots in Jerusalem, where it was founded in 1901 as a small drug distribution business by Chaim Salomon, Moshe Levin, and Yitschak Elstein. Over the following decades, the company evolved and eventually took the name Teva Pharmaceutical Industries Ltd. in 1976 following a major merger.

As the world's largest manufacturer of generic medicines, Teva operates a vast global network of production facilities. Consequently, Sertralina Teva is manufactured in multiple countries, including significant sites in Israel, Europe (notably Hungary and Germany), and North America. Ownership remains with Teva Pharmaceutical Industries Ltd., headquartered in Tel Aviv, Israel, which is a publicly-traded multinational corporation and a leader in both generic and specialty biopharmaceuticals.
